Building raising services involve the process of elevating an existing structure to a higher level, typically to prevent flood damage or to comply with updated building regulations. This service requires the careful lifting of a building from its foundation, often utilizing specialized equipment and techniques to ensure structural integrity throughout the process. Once elevated, the foundation is repaired, reinforced, or replaced as needed, and the building is lowered back onto the new or improved foundation. This process can be complex and requires coordination with experienced professionals who understand the structural and engineering considerations involved.

The overview below groups typical Building Raising proj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Michigan City, IN.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Foundation Raising Costs - The cost for raising a building foundation typically ranges from $10,000 to $30,000 depending on the size and complexity of the project. Larger or more complex structures may incur higher expenses. Local pros can provide detailed estimates based on specific needs.
Permitting and Inspection Fees - Permits and inspections usually add between $500 and $2,000 to the overall cost. These fees vary by location and project scope, with some areas requiring additional documentation or approvals.
Structural Reinforcement Expenses - Reinforcing a building during raising can cost approximately $5,000 to $15,000. The price depends on the extent of reinforcement needed and the building's size and condition.
Additional Service Charges - Extra services such as site preparation or debris removal can range from $1,000 to $5,000. Costs vary based on site conditions and the scope of auxiliary work required by local service providers.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
